[Collaboration of Light-up and Light-carving art at Zen temple]


The Light-up event wil be held at Myoshinji taizoin Temple in Kyoto from Dec.15(Mon.) to Dec.25(Thu).

The area to be illuminated includes "Motonobu's Garden", a dry landscape garden created by Motonobu Kano, which was designated in Muromachi period and was specified as a national place of scenic beauty and historic interest, and "Hyotan-Pond" in Yoko-en, a garden created by Kinsaku Nakane as a landscape architect, will be illuminated.  

Unlike the glittering light of the city, the beautiful Japanese garden will be enveloped in a magical blue light.



"Hikaribori" works by Yurukawa Fu, the only one artist who creates works using the technique in the world, will be exhibited.  

"Hikaribori" is a completed work using Styrofoam which is insulation material used for the interior walls of the building, and  LED lights illuminate from behind.  The surface of the insulation material is scraped or melted to create an uneven surface that appears to float three-dimensionally, and blue light seems to be absorbed into the work is fantastic.  The works are going to be exhibited in a dark place because the works must be used light, and it will be held in Taizo-in of Myoshin-ji Temple at a time when it is not usually open to the public.

[Bringing Japanese contemporary art to the world]


The 600 year-old Zen question and answer "Hyonenzu" is a painting depicting the question "How do you   catch a slimy moving catfish with a gourd(hyotan)?"  At the event, a total of 12 works will be exhibited, including new light carvings with answers to Zen questions solicited in advance.  The day before event, the works will be livestreamed from 4:30 to 5:00 p.m.(tentative) on Sunday,  Dec. 14.  In Taizoin, where the light carving arts exhibited,  the sofa couple seats will be pripaired for viewing the works,  the discussion between Mr.  Yurukawa Fu and Mr.  Daiko Matsuyama,  Deputy Priest of Myoshinji Temple Taizoin on 18th(Thu.),  a photo contest of light-up and light carving art (during the event),  and the workshops will be planned for limited days only.
